Introduction: The Evolution of Risk Mechanics in Online Slots

As the online gambling industry matures, developers continuously innovate to enhance player engagement and retention. One prominent feature that has gained popularity across numerous slot titles is the “gamble” or “risk” mechanic. This feature introduces an element of strategic decision-making, contrasting with the traditional passive spin. Its integration offers players an adrenaline-fueled experience, artificially heightening perceived stakes and potentially increasing session durations.

Technical and Ethical Considerations

While the gamble mechanic offers excitement, developers face the challenge of ensuring transparency and fairness. Random Number Generators (RNGs) must guarantee unbiased outcomes, and clear communication about the risks involved is paramount. The example of the Eye of Horus game demonstrates that users are often presented with simplified options—like selecting red or black—to maintain player trust.

Responsible implementation also means offering self-imposed limits and time-outs, especially when introducing gamble options, which can incite impulsive behaviour if not correctly managed.
